ABOUT THE SWORD DANCE UNION

 

The Sword Dance Union (SDU) was founded in 2005 with the aim of encouraging, developing and maintaining traditional sword dances.  The Union seeks to provide useful practical support to sword dance teams across the UK and internationally.  The Sword Dance Union aims to develop a stronger public understanding of the traditions involved.

It is run by a small but dedicated group who aim to provide sword teams with a communication network, practical and personal advice, archive material, competitive opportunities and in the UK, rapper or longsword loan. 

The Union runs events and competitions all over the UK, giving teams the chance to perform in front of their peers, sharpen up their dance skills and deepen their personal  understanding of the linked sword tradition.

Membership of the SDU is open to all individuals and sword dance teams who support the Union’s aims and objectives.
